Princeton Removes Greek, Latin for Classics Majors to Combat Racism
May 31, 2021
Princeton University decided recently to remove Greek and Latin for Classics majors to combat – what it called- institutional racism.
Faculty members approved changes to the Classics department, including eliminating the “classics” track, which required an intermediate proficiency in Greek or Latin to enter the concentration, according to Princeton Alumni Weekly. The requirement for students to take Greek or Latin was also removed.
A diversity and equity statement on the department’s site says that the “history of our own department bears witness to the place of Classics in the long arc of systemic racism.”
